Evaluation of the Energy Efficiency of Household Electrical Appliances

Physics2025, Undergraduate

This study evaluated the energy efficiency of common household electrical appliances. Power consumption and useful output were measured for representative appliances, and efficiency and standby consumption were estimated. The findings revealed wide variation in efficiency across appliance types and ages, with older units and standby modes consuming disproportionately. The study observed labelling gaps in the market. It recommends energy labelling, consumer guidance, and standby power reduction measures.
